Comprehending the Transition: Cots to Tots
The term "Cots to Tots" typically describes the transition from crib sleeping to young child beds, typically taking place between the ages of 18 months and 3 years. Throughout this phase, children experience considerable physical and cognitive development, and moms and dads play an essential role in ensuring their children adapt well to these modifications.
Key Milestones in the Cots to Tots Transition
Physical Growth: As toddlers become more mobile, they frequently grow out of the boundaries of a crib. Indications that a kid is prepared to shift include climbing out of the crib or no longer fitting comfortably in it.

Cognitive Development: Cognitive abilities are growing during this time, and kids start to assert their self-reliance. They might reveal choices, desire to select their sleeping plans, or reveal interest in developing regimens.

Emotional Growth: Emotionally, toddlers begin to develop a complacency and autonomy. They may experience nighttime worries or separation stress and anxiety, highlighting the requirement for a cautious method during this shift.
The Importance of Choosing the Right Toddler Bed
Picking the right young child bed is an essential step in the cots to tots transition. Here are a couple of aspects to consider:
Safety: Look for beds with rounded edges, durable building and construction, and steady guardrails to avoid falls.Size and Height: Choose a bed that's low to the ground to make it simple for toddlers to climb in and out individually.Product: Select non-toxic surfaces and products that can endure the wear and tear of toddler life.Style: Aesthetics matter too! Pick a design that matches the kid's character and complements the space decor.Suggestions for a Smooth Transition
Here is a list of practical tips to relieve the transition from cots to young children:

Prepare the Environment: Create a safe sleeping environment by eliminating sharp things and using safety gates as necessary to restrict access to stairs or other locations.

Develop a Routine: Establish a constant bedtime regimen to assist your kid feel protected. Activities such as reading, singing lullabies, or bath time can signify that it's time for sleep.

Encourage Independence: Allow your kid to be associated with selecting their bed and bed linen to promote a sense of ownership and excitement about the new modification.

Address Nighttime Fears: Offer convenience products such as packed animals or blankets that assist your kid feel safe.

Be Patient: Transitioning can take time. If your child struggles in the beginning, reassure them that it's a natural part of growing up.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: When should I transition my child from a crib to a young child bed?
Many kids transition in between 18 months and 3 years, depending upon their personal readiness. Try to find indications like climbing up out of the crib or showing interest in a big-kid bed.
Q2: What if my child refuses to sleep in the brand-new bed?
It's typical for young children to withstand modification. Developing a bedtime regimen, using comfort products, and providing praise for any development can assist reduce the transition.
Q3: Are young child beds safe?
Yes, as long as they meet security requirements. Try to find features like guardrails, low height, and strong building to ensure safety.
Q4: How can I prevent my child from falling out of bed?
Go with young child beds with guardrails and location cushions or soft rugs on the floor to soften any possible falls.
Q5: Is it essential to buy a new bed, or can I utilize a bed mattress on the flooring?
While a bed mattress on the flooring might work temporarily, a young child bed offers stability and safety features that enable more independence during sleep.
